Background

DGCR8 is a component of the microprocessor complex that functions as an RNA- and heme-binding protein involved in the initial step of microRNA (miRNA) biogenesis. Within the microprocessor complex, DGCR8 processes primary miRNA transcripts (pri-miRNAs) into precursor miRNAs (pre-miRNAs). It acts as a molecular anchor to recognize the dsRNA-ssRNA junction of pri-miRNAs and directs DROSHA to cleave 11 bp away from the junction, releasing hairpin-shaped pre-miRNAs for subsequent processing by cytoplasmic DICER into mature miRNAs. The heme-bound DGCR8 dimer binds pri-miRNAs cooperatively as a trimer (of dimers) to trigger cleavage, while the heme-free monomer binds as a dimer with reduced activity. Both double-stranded and single-stranded regions of pri-miRNAs are required for binding. DGCR8 specifically recognizes and binds N6-methyladenosine (m6A)-modified pri-miRNAs, a key modification for processing. It is also involved in silencing embryonic stem cell self-renewal (by similar) and plays a role in DNA repair by promoting RNF168 recruitment to RNF8 and MDC1 at double-strand breaks for DNA damage clearance.
